Solution for -3(y-2)=1-2y equation:


Simplifying
-3(y + -2) = 1 + -2y

Reorder the terms:
-3(-2 + y) = 1 + -2y
(-2 * -3 + y * -3) = 1 + -2y
(6 + -3y) = 1 + -2y

Solving
6 + -3y = 1 + -2y

Solving for variable 'y'.

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'2y' to each side of the equation.
6 + -3y + 2y = 1 + -2y + 2y

Combine like terms: -3y + 2y = -1y
6 + -1y = 1 + -2y + 2y

Combine like terms: -2y + 2y = 0
6 + -1y = 1 + 0
6 + -1y = 1

Add '-6' to each side of the equation.
6 + -6 + -1y = 1 + -6

Combine like terms: 6 + -6 = 0
0 + -1y = 1 + -6
-1y = 1 + -6

Combine like terms: 1 + -6 = -5
-1y = -5

Divide each side by '-1'.
y = 5

Simplifying
y = 5
